How to Replace Catalytic Converter and Pipe Assembly 2010-2014 Subaru Outback 2.5L H4

Shop for New Auto Parts at 1AAuto.com https://1aau.to/c/93/bq/direct-fit-ca... This video shows you how to install a new catalytic converter & pipe assembly from TRQ on your 2010-2014 Subaru Outback 2.5L H4.
